Old Fashioned Chocolate Cake
- 4 1/2 (1-ounce each) bars HERSHEY'S Unsweetened Baking Chocolate, broken into pieces
1/2 cup water
3/4 cup butter, softened
2 1/4 cups granulated sugar
6 large eggs, separated
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
2 2/3 cups cake flour
3 teaspoons baking powder
3/4 teaspoon salt
3/4 cup milk
- Heat oven to 350°F. Grease and flour 13 x 9 x 2-inch baking pan.
- Combine chocolate and water in small saucepan. Cook over low heat, stirring occasionally, until chocolate is melted. Set aside to cool slightly.
- Beat butter and sugar in large mixer bowl until light and fluffy. Add egg yolks and vanilla; beat well. Add chocolate; beat until blended.
- Stir together flour, baking powder and salt; add alternately with milk to butter mixture.
- Beat egg whites in medium bowl until stiff, but not dry; fold into batter. Pour batter into prepared pan.
- Bake 45 to 50 minutes or until wooden pick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ool completely in pan on wire rack.
- Frost as desired.
Makes 12 to 15 servings.
